VMware 12虚拟机安装Windows XP系统教程

vmware12装xp

时间:2025-03-11 09:09


在VMware 12中完美安装Windows XP:详尽指南 在虚拟化技术日益成熟的今天,VMware Workstation 12作为一款强大的桌面虚拟化软件,凭借其出色的性能和兼容性,成为了许多IT专业人士和爱好者的首选工具

    尽管Windows XP已经逐渐退出历史舞台,但在某些特定场景或遗留应用中,XP系统依然扮演着重要角色

    本文将详细介绍如何在VMware Workstation 12中安装并优化Windows XP,以确保其运行流畅且稳定

     一、准备工作 1. 下载VMware Workstation 12 首先,确保你已经安装了VMware Workstation 12

    如果尚未安装,可以从VMware官方网站下载最新版本

    安装过程中,请按照提示完成所有步骤,包括注册和许可证输入

     2. 准备Windows XP安装镜像 你需要一个合法的Windows XP安装镜像文件(ISO)

    可以从微软官方网站或其他合法渠道获取

    确保下载的文件完整无损,以避免安装过程中出现问题

     3. 创建虚拟机 打开VMware Workstation 12,点击“新建虚拟机”按钮,开始创建新的虚拟机

     - 选择典型或自定义安装:对于大多数用户,选择“典型(推荐)”安装即可

    如果需要更多自定义选项,如设置硬盘大小、内存分配等,可以选择“自定义”

     - 安装来源:选择“安装程序光盘映像文件(ISO)”,然后浏览到你的Windows XP安装镜像文件

     - 操作系统和客户机操作系统:选择“Microsoft Windows”,“版本”选择“Windows XP Professional”或相应的版本

     - 命名虚拟机:为你的虚拟机命名,并选择存放虚拟机文件的位置

     - 配置硬盘大小:建议至少分配20GB的硬盘空间给XP虚拟机,以容纳操作系统、应用程序及数据

     - 自定义硬件:在此步骤中,你可以调整分配给虚拟机的内存大小

    对于Windows XP,建议分配至少1GB的内存,但不超过宿主机物理内存的50%,以保证宿主机的正常运行

     二、安装Windows XP 1. 启动虚拟机 完成虚拟机配置后,点击“完成”按钮

    VMware将自动启动虚拟机并开始加载Windows XP安装程序

     2. 安装过程 语言选择:根据需要选择安装语言

     - 同意许可协议:阅读并接受Windows XP许可协议

     - 分区和格式化:在磁盘分区界面,选择“未分配的磁盘空间”,点击“下一步”进行分区和格式化

    建议选择“使用NTFS文件系统格式化分区”,以提高安全性和性能

     - 安装设置:输入产品密钥、计算机名、管理员密码等信息,继续安装

     - 复制文件:安装程序将开始复制文件到硬盘

    此过程可能需要一段时间,请耐心等待

     - 重启:安装完成后,虚拟机会自动重启

    在重启过程中,可能会要求你进行一些额外的设置,如调整屏幕分辨率、创建用户账户等

     三、优化Windows XP虚拟机 虽然Windows XP可以在VMware Workstation 12中直接运行,但通过一些优化措施,可以显著提升其性能和兼容性

     1. 安装VMware Tools VMware Tools是一套用于增强虚拟机性能和功能的软件套件

    安装VMware Tools后,可以实现以下功能: - 全屏模式:使虚拟机全屏显示,提高视觉体验

     - 自动调整分辨率:根据宿主机分辨率自动调整虚拟机窗口大小

     - 共享文件夹:在宿主机和虚拟机之间共享文件

     - 鼠标指针同步:在虚拟机窗口内外平滑切换鼠标指针

     在Windows XP虚拟机中,通过“虚拟机”菜单选择“安装VMware Tools”

    随后,在虚拟机内部将自动弹出VMware Tools安装向导,按照提示完成安装即可

     2. 更新驱动程序 尽管VMware Workstation提供了基本的硬件虚拟化,但为了确保最佳性能和兼容性,建议更新虚拟机的显卡、网卡等驱动程序

    你可以访问VMware官方网站下载最新的VMware Tools和驱动程序更新包

     3. 调整电源管理设置 在Windows XP的电源管理设置中,关闭屏幕保护和休眠功能,以减少不必要的资源消耗

    同时,确保虚拟机设置为“高性能”电源计划,以提高整体性能

     4. 禁用不必要的服务 通过“服务”管理器(services.msc),禁用一些不必要的后台服务,如Windows Update、自动播放等,以释放系统资源

    注意,禁用服务时需谨慎,避免影响系统的关键功能

     5. 安装安全更新 尽管Windows XP已不再受到微软官方支持,但你仍可以通过第三方安全软件(如防病毒软件和防火墙)来保护虚拟机免受恶意软件攻击

    同时,定期检查并安装可用的安全补丁和更新

     四、解决常见问题 在安装和优化Windows XP虚拟机的过程中,可能会遇到一些常见问题

    以下是一些常见的故障排除方法: 1. 无法识别USB设备 确保VMware Workstation的USB控制器已启用,并正确连接到虚拟机

    在虚拟机设置中,检查USB控制器配置,确保选择了正确的USB版本(如USB 2.0或USB 3.0)

    此外,确保安装了VMware Tools中的USB驱动程序

     2. 网络连接问题 如果虚拟机无法访问互联网或局域网,请检查网络适配器设置

    在虚拟机设置中,确保选择了正确的网络连接类型(如NAT、桥接或仅主机模式)

    同时,检查虚拟机的IP地址、子网掩码和默认网关设置是否正确

     3. 图形性能不佳 如果虚拟机中的图形性能不佳,尝试调整虚拟机的显示设置

    在虚拟机设置中,增加分配给虚拟机的视频内存大小,并启用3D加速功能(如果可用)

    此外,确保安装了最新的显卡驱动程序

     4. 声音问题 如果虚拟机中没有声音输出,请检查声音设备设置

    在虚拟机设置中,确保启用了声音设备,并选择了正确的音频输出设备

    同时,确保安装了VMware Tools中的音频驱动程序

     五、结论 通过在VMware Workstation 12中安装和优化Windows XP虚拟机,你可以轻松地在现代硬件上运行旧版软件和应用

    尽管Windows XP已经过时,但通过合理的配置和优化,它仍然能够在虚拟化环境中发挥余热

    本文提供的详细步骤和故障排除方法将帮助你顺利完成Windows XP虚拟机的安装和优化工作

    无论你是IT专业人士还是普通用户,都能从中受益,享受虚拟化技术带来的便利和高效